Brucite chemically is magnesium hydroxide, and is found in many places around the world. The species has been observed in a myriad of colors, but they are often softer, more pastel hues. In the last few years, some rare YELLOW specimens have come out of the Killa Saifullah area in Pakistan, and they are some of the most vividly colored Brucites you'll find. The intense yellow color is exceptionally rare for the species, and the saturation of these groups combined with the fact that they have formed attractive specimens on matrix makes them incredibly desirable for species collectors and display collectors alike. This small cabinet specimen hosts semi-spherical, lustrous, translucent, yellow groups of Brucite with minor attached matrix. When backlit, the main cluster of Brucite "balls" GLOWS with color.
